MisCast Cast Announced



MisCast is 'a strange and wonderful cabaret' according to Dave Dorrell, who designed the artwork. (Dave and his wife Jennifer were active members of Jackson's community theater before moving to Georgia many years ago.) Everyone who is participating in MisCast got to choose a song that belongs to a great role for which they are totally unsuited and would never be cast in! Great fun.

MisCast runs for two weekends with two different casts! Director Timm Richardson, who is putting the show together, is also serving as emcee. Accompanying most performers is Sherra Zuck.

Performance Network


Ann Arbor's Performance Network is in trouble. The theatre has to raise $40,000 by April 15th or it will close. Click here to read the short article. They have reached over $13,000 this evening towards their goal of $20,000. A group of Board members and long-time supporters will match all gifts made by April 15th up to $20,000, new donations or increased pledges, dollar for dollar, until the goal is reached.

Gary Wetzel-Righettini 1952 - 2009


The theatre community has lost a very special person. Gary Wetzel-Righettini was killed in a car accident on Saturday morning, April 4, 2009.
